Particular features of the specification are: Tests Class 1 and Class 2 equipment. Allows Earth Bond measurements to be controlled at low currents (100mA). Earth Bond currents are electronically controlled for accuracy and safety. Clear digital display with electronic hold of last reading at end of test. Additional BS4343 socket for testing 110V appliances.
Layout - VERY EASY TO USE AND FAST The Ethos 9150 is contained in a robust ABS/Polycarbonate injection-moulded case which accommodates all the high voltage, power and control components in the base section and the measurement and display electronics in the lid section. The lid section features a large LCD for the display of measurements and OVERFLOW and FUSE OK LED indicators. The OVERFLOW indicator will illuminate when the measurement exceeds the maximum display range on the LCD display. A sturdy zip pouch located at the rear of the instrument contains all the necessary test leads and the mains supply connector. Access is also available to additional test sockets for 4 wire Earth Bond tests and remote Insulation Resistance measurements. The base control panel of the instrument features a rotary switch for test selection and a push button test switch with associated LED indicators. A number of safety features are included in the instrument design and these include; 1) Fuse protection. 2) Thermal trip on electronic components to prevent failure due to over heating of unit. 3) Fail-safe crowbar system to prevent internal test relays from being continuously powered in the remote possibility of failure of the control electronics. Applications The Ethos 9150 is designed to check the electrical safety of portable appliances and its use allows for appliances of class 1 and class 2 to be checked. As a guide BS and IEC standard define these two categories of insulation a follows; Class 1 – Appliances which have Basic Insulation throughout and have exposed conductive (typically metal) parts connected to earth. These are often described as earthed appliances. Class 2 – Appliance which is protected by Double Insulation can be identified by the symbol. Different regulations and standards describe a variety of tests for electrical appliances and in general cover approval tests. Such testing involves prolonged sophisticated tests. It is generally recognised that for periodic inspection to ensure the safety of the appliance is maintained, tests of the types performed by the Ethos 9150 are realistic and satisfactory and are described in the IEE code of practice for in-service inspection and testing of Electrical Equipment.
